Jerry Dell Marshall,68, of Bayboro entered into eternal rest on Sunday, September 22, 2024 at CarolinaEast Medical Center.
Viewing hours are 3:00 PM to 6:30 PM Thursday and 9:30 AM to 5:00 PM Friday at the Mortuary..
His service is 1:00 PM, Saturday, September 28, 2024 at St. Galilee M. B. Church, Maribel Community of Bayboro. The interment will follow in the Marshall Family Cemetery.
He is survived by his mother, Hazel Marshall; two daughters, Jessica Marshall and Latrice Brown; two sons, Terry Marshall and Jerry Marshall; two brothers, George Marshall and Bruce Marshall; two sisters, Velma Hamilton and Helen Gaynell Gibbs; twelve grandchildren and three great grandchildren.
